Goals It is to analyze Georgian history in a wholeness of the 19th century.
Course Content King III. Davit Kurapalati Period, the founding of the United Kingdom of Georgia and King III. Bagrati, the Kings; I. Giorgi and IV. Bagrati and II. Political and economic structure in Georgia during Giorgi era.
Learning Outcomes - He knows the basic dynamics of Georgian history.
- Analyzes the changes and continuities in Georgian history.
- It assesses the location of the Georgians in the context of global history.
- It liaises between Georgian history and Turkish and Turkish history.
Weekly Topics (Content)
Week Topics Learning Methods
1. Week King III. Davit Kurapalati Period.
2. Week The founding of the United Kingdom of Great Britain and King III. Bagrati.
3. Week Kings; I. Giorgi and IV. Bagrati and II. Political and economic structure in Georgia during Giorgi era.
4. Week King Davit Ağmaşenebeli The political events of the aged period.
5. Week Didgori war and its consequences.
6. Week The reforms of the King Davit Ağmaşenebi.
7. Week King III. Giorgi period.
8. Week Midterm
9. Week Queen Tamari's throne and political events.
10. Week The reforms of Queen Tamari.
11. Week Basiani war and its consequences.
12. Week Mongolian attacks.
13. Week Georgia for 13-16. centuries.
14. Week Late feudal period.
